Analysis

In 2025, share of electricity generation from solar and wind in United Kingdom stood at 36.0%. That is the highest value across all 106 years on record.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 4.2% on the previous year and up 155.0% over ten years.

Over the whole period, share of electricity generation from solar and wind in United Kingdom peaked at 36.0% in 2025 and was at its lowest, 0.0%, in 1920.

United Kingdom ranks 16th of 211 countries on this measure, in the top 10%.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Averages by decade

DecadeAverage LowestHighest Years
1920s 0.0% 0.0% 0.0% 10
1930s 0.0% 0.0% 0.0% 10
1940s 0.0% 0.0% 0.0% 10
1950s 0.0% 0.0% 0.0% 10
1960s 0.0% 0.0% 0.0% 10
1970s 0.0% 0.0% 0.0% 10
1980s 0.0% 0.0% 0.0% 10
1990s 0.1% 0.0% 0.2% 10
2000s 0.9% 0.2% 2.5% 10
2010s 12.2% 2.7% 23.3% 10
2020s 30.9% 25.0% 36.0% 6
